CM Punk's music plays and that means he is going to make his way to the ring.
Punk says he is happy to be here and he says he had a few goals when he returned. He wanted to main event Wrestlemania and become the WWE Champion. One was achieved, but things have gotten in the way of the other. Now he can focus on being World Champion. After last week, he is the number one contender for Gunther's title. He says Gunther is one of the best wrestlers in the world. He says he is looking very forward to lacing up and locking up with Gunther. He says he cannot guarantee a win, but with you cheering for him in the arena or at home, he promises he will leave it all in the ring. He says he will not quit. He says he will give everything he has.
He says Gunther is one of the best in the world. He was IC champion for 666 days and he is a two time World Champion. Punk says he has two weeks to prepare but Punk says he has been doing this his entire career. He tells Gunther and his fans, he is not any other wrestler or any other contender. He is the best in the world.
Gunther's music interrupts and Gunther makes his way to the ring.
Gunther and Punk stand face to face.
Gunther steps back and he stares at Punk and Punk stares back.
Gunther says he is excited to hear and he says he did not come out to throw insults at Punk or create any drama. He points out that they are both here for the same reason. Not to make friends, but make money and win championships. They both consider each other the best in the world. You have a massive ego and Gunther says he has a massive ego. Gunther says his ego is justified. It is not based on what they think. Gunther says his ego is based on his results. The best in the world is the man who holds the World Championship. Gunther says he only cares about what happens after the bell rings. He will make sure that Punk regrets ever stepping in a wrestling ring. He says he will tap him out and make Punk realize that he was right that Punk will never be World Champion or best in the world.
Gunther says he gets to have the degenerates chant for him for the rest of his life.

Match Number One: Rusev versus Sheamus
Sheamus goes for a Brogue Kick as the bell rings and Rusev avoids it and goes to the floor. Sheamus follows Rusev and they exchange punches. Sheamus and Rusev send each other into the ringside barrier. Sheamus sends Rusev into the ringside barrier and back into the ring. Rusev misses an elbow drop but connects with a kick and follows with a suplex. Rusev with a second suplex for a near fall. Rusev chokes Sheamus in the ropes. Sheamus punches Rusev in the midsection and follows with more punches. Sheamus gets Rusev on his shoulder and he hits a Finlay Slam and a knee drop for a near fall. Sheamus with a punch and forearms. Rusev and Sheamus exchange punches. Sheamus sends Rusev into the turnbuckles and Rusev with an Irish whip and clothesline. Rusev with forearms to the back and he hits a belly-to-back suplex.
Sheamus with a clothesline. Sheamus sends Rusev to the floor and hen he brings him back to the apron and he tries for the forearms but Rusev drops Sheamus on the top rope. Sheamus with knee lits to Rusev on the apron. Sheamus tries to go to the floor but he slips and goes back into the ring. Sheamus goes back up and hits a clothesline off he turnbuckles to the floor and then he goes Maximus to the crowd. Rusev with a fallaway slam onto the announce table. Rusev returns to the ring and he tells the referee to stop checking on Sheamus to make the count. Sheamus gets the nine count power up to return to the ring before the referee gets to ten.
Rusev with kicks to Sheamus. Rusev with an elbow drop and he gets a near fall. Rusev with a cravate. Sheamus with punches and Rusev with a flying spinning heel kick for a near fall. Rusev chokes Sheamus in the ropes. Rusev with a kick to the back. Sheamus with punches to Rusev and running double sledges. Sheamus with a clothesline into the corner and a uranage back breaker. Sheamus runs into a boot and Sheamus with a power slam for a near fall. Sheamus with knees when Rusev tries to block the forearms on the apron and Sheamus with the forearms to Rusev. Sheamus signals for the Brogue Kick and Sheamus catches Rusev and hits a power bomb for a near fall.
Rusev sets for the Matchka Kick but Sheamus with a jumping knee for a near fall. Sheamus goes to the turnbuckles and Rusev with an elbow and chops. Rusev goes for a superplex but Sheamus blocks it. Sheamus with punches and a head butt to send Rusev to the mat. Sheamus comes off the turnbuckles but Rusev is too far away. Rusev with a super kick for a near fall. Rusev applies the Accolade. Sheamus tries to get to his feet or to the ropes but Rusev stops that attempt. Rusev smothers Sheamus but Sheamus gets to the ropes. Rusev calls Sheamus a stubborn mule and he tells him to tap out. Sheamus tells Rusev to kicks him so Rusev does it. Rusev chokes Sheamus and Sheamus wants more. Rusev pulls off the turnbuckle pad but Sheamus blocks it. SHeamus punches Rusev and sends him into the turnbuckle. The referee fixes the turnbuckle but Sheamus stops Rusev from using the shillelagh with a Brogue Kick for the three count.
Winner: Sheamus
